  • Abstract
    While applying particle swarm optimization to solving traveling salesman problem, some encoding schemes can´t utilize well flying character. Particle swarm optimization based on neighborhood encoding for solving traveling salesman problem is put forward in this paper. Scheme of neighborhood encoding makes particles flying efficaciously to interesting region, and eventually makes particle swarm optimization converging with higher efficiency than those utilizing other encoding schemes. Simulation results indicate that new encoding scheme is efficacious.
